0.00
0 читателей, 4902 топика

Как я легкий дистрибутив искал Обзор (спойлер!) LXLE Linux


В этом видео я сравниваю, сколько оперативной памяти занимают разные дистрибутивы Linux. Это может быть полезно например тем, кто хочет запускать линукс на старом ноутбуке с 2 ГБ ОЗУ или в виртуальной машине на системе, где доступно относительно немного свободной RAM.
Этот обзор — всего лишь мой личный эксперимент, который я решил провести на имеющихся под рукой дистрибутивах Линукс. Пожалуйста помните, что ваши результаты могут отличаться от моих и что со временем ситуация может поменяться.
В моем сравнении участвовали дистрибутивы Linux Mint, Manjaro, KDE NEON, Solus Budgie, Xubuntu, Lubuntu и LXLE. В неравной борьбе именно последний и оказался победителем.
Только вам, дорогой зритель, решать, каким именно дистрибутивом пользоваться: все они разные и предлагают разные наборы функций и украшений. Нужно лишь понять, на чем остановиться. А может, перепробовать все? :)

Linux Mint: главные настройки сразу после установки(Урок №4)


Продолжаем изучать Linux Mint (XFCE). Сразу после установки ОС нужно еще сделать три важных операции, о которых часто забывают новички. Или просто не знают.

Это базовые операции, которые впоследствии сэкономят много времени и сил.

А именно:

Настроить резервное копирование при помощи программы TimeShift. Настроим расписание создания резервных копий.
Обновить операционную систему.
И создать пользователя с ограниченными правами. А затем включим его в расписание резервного копирования.

Вот сегодня я и покажу как это делается в этом небольшом видео.

И обещанные вспомогательные видео, которые дополнят основное видео:

Linux Mint: резервное копирование с TimeShift. Быстрая инструкция:

youtu.be/FI25GOwA7JU

Зачем нужно создавать пользователя с ограниченными правами в Linux? Как это влияет на безопасность?

youtu.be/z39jsxVUDPw

Если вы впервые попали на этот курс, то советую посмотреть предыдущие части этого небольшого курса для новичков, которые впервые знакомятся с Linux Mint:

Установка Linux Mint с флешки: пошаговая инструкция (Урок №1)

youtu.be/WU-NmNORDH4

Linux: как разбить жесткий диск на разделы? (Урок №2)

youtu.be/e_p_Ed8C9Yo

Linux Mint: как настроить переключение языка ввода на клавиатуре и сделать русский языком «по-умолчанию» (Урок №»3)

youtu.be/_H2DFyTMdpw

Дефрагментация жесткого диска, почему иногда это вредно?


Почему не на всех компьютерах можно делать дефрагментацию. Как быстро сделать дефрагментацию и насколько часто нужно ее делать? С помощью какой программы выполнить дефрагментацию жесткого диска?

INSTAGRAM: www.instagram.com/voronxak/

Я в VK: vk.com/ivan.voronin

Подписаться на канал автора: www.youtube.com/c/IvanVoronin-VoRoNXaK

Группа компьютерной поддержки Вконтакте: vk.com/voron_xak

А тут я помогаю в одноклассниках: ok.ru/onlinekom

Подробная статья что такое дефрагментация: voron-xak.ru/vseokompe/defragmentaciya.html

Используемые материалы.

Скачать программу Auslogics Disk Defrag Free для выполнения дефрагментации: www.auslogics.com/ru/software/disk-defrag/after-download/

ПОДСВЕТКА СИНТАКСИСА SQL. ИТОГ. #3


Это заключительная часть серии. Еще немного багов, еще немного отладки, и красивый результат! Готовая подсветка для любого языка на javascript с использованием библиотеки colors. Разработку и тестирование мы веди на площадке repl.it

Исходный код
repl.it/repls/TechnicalGracefulRelationalmodel#index.js

ВК: Сергей Терехов

vk.com/sergeiterehov

ВК: Группа Программирование с нуля

vk.com/sergeiterehov.school.start

Установка бесплатного SSL-сертификата (A-grade) Lets Encrypt на nginx (Ubuntu 16.04)


Установка бесплатного SSL-сертификата (A-grade) Lets Encrypt на nginx (Ubuntu 16.04):
sudo openssl req -x509 -nodes -days 365 -newkey rsa:2048 -keyout /etc/nginx/nginx.key -out /etc/nginx/nginx.crt #Генерируем самоподписанный сертификат
sudo openssl dhparam -out /etc/nginx/dhparam.pem 2048 #Генерируем ключ для шифрования (необязательно, необходимо для оценки A)
sudo nano /etc/nginx/sites-enabled/default #Редактируем настройки nginx
//(раскомментировать listen 443 ssl default_server; и изменить server_name _; ssl_dhparam /etc/nginx/dhparam.pem;)
//(добавить ssl_certificate /etc/nginx/nginx.crt; ssl_certificate_key /etc/nginx/nginx.key; )
//DNS должен корректно указывать на наш сервер по всем именам, порты 80 и 443 должны быть открыты
sudo nginx -t # Проверим что конфиг nginx без ошибок
sudo service nginx reload #Перезапустим nginx и проверим что SSL работает
sudo apt-get update #Обновим индексы пакетов
sudo apt-get install software-properties-common #Установим пакет для управления репозиториями
sudo add-apt-repository ppa:certbot/certbot #Добавим репозиторий certbot
sudo apt-get update #Еще раз обновим индексы пакетов
sudo apt-get install python-certbot-nginx #Установим certbot с плагином для nginx
sudo certbot --nginx #Запускаем «мастер» установки сертификата
sudo crontab -e #Отредактируем root cron
0 3 11 */2 * /usr/bin/certbot renew --post-hook «systemctl reload nginx» --force-renew #Обновляем сертификат в 3 утра 11 числа каждого 2-го месяца и перезагружаем конфиг в nginx

www.ssllabs.com/ssltest/ — Тест SSL Grade
certbot.eff.org/#ubuntuxenial-nginx — Официальное руководство Certbot
Использована музыка Lee Rosevere

Azure DevOps - сервис для организации жизненного цикла программного продукта / В. Гусаров


Приглашаем на DevOpsConf live! — профессиональную конференцию по интеграции процессов разработки, тестирования и эксплуатации
29 -30 сентября и 6-7 октября 2020
Подробности и билеты bit.ly/2NGn8Tt
— РИТ 2019, DevOps Conf

Тезисы и презентация:
devopsconf.io/moscow-rit/2019/abstracts/5165

Вы узнаете об эволюции и новых возможностях сервиса. Мы в деталях разберем все пять основных его компонентов и сделаем упор на Azure Pipelines — гибкую систему CI/CD c неограниченными возможностями собирать что угодно и деплоить куда угодно.
— Нашли ошибку в видео? Пишите нам на support@ontico.ru

Как правильно увольняться программисту


Рано или поздно у любого программиста возникает потребность (или необходимость) уволиться. Поговорим о том. как это правильно делать. О том, как это принято в IT и о том, что делать ни в коем случае не надо. Короче — как правильно уволиться. чтобы тебе это потом не аукнулось

Новый тренинг для новичков (Киев и онлайн): инструментарий Java bit.ly/2MZEOvS

Проверь, достаточно ли тебе знаний чтобы начать обучение на курсе Java менторинг в FoxmindEd? bit.ly/2WVswnK

Advanced он-лайн курс Enterprise Patterns: bit.ly/2WQRPaF

Сайт учебного центра: bit.ly/2RoY9VI
Учебный центр в ФБ: www.facebook.com/foxmindedco

Разработка: software.foxminded.com.ua
Web-разработка: foxminded.agency

Мой Telegram: t.me/nemchinskiyOnBusiness
Мой блог: www.nemchinsky.me
Мой ФБ: www.facebook.com/sergey.nemchinskiy

3.Linux для Начинающих - Работа с Терминалом


3.Linux для Начинающих — Работа с Терминалом

man – помощь
info – тоже помощь
uptime — время с последнего включения
lscpu – данные процессора
whatis – показывает что делает комманда
whereis – показывает где файл
locate – показывает где файл
ls — показать что в этой директории
ls –la –R / — показать все на компутере
Ctrl Z — отправить процесс на background
Ctrl C – прекратить процесс вообще

Буду рад паре баксов, можно даже Канадских :) www.paypal.me/DenisAstahov

Виктор Лапин — Введение в AOSP, или Как потратить ночь на сборку Android


. Расскажем, что такое AOSP, из чего он состоит, почему это не то же самое, что Google Android, и каким образом можно собрать готовую прошивку для конкретного устройства.